Appendix F IPID Function Block

AutoTune

Input

BOOL

Start AutoTune sequence

ATParameters

Input

AT_Param

Autotune parameters
See AT_Param Data Type

Output

Output

Real

Output value from the controller

AbsoluteError

Output

Real

AbsoluteError is the difference between Process
value and set point value

ATWarnings

Output

DINT

Warning for the Auto Tune sequence. Possible value
are:

0 — No auto tune done

1 — Auto tuning in progress

2 — Auto tuning done

-1 — Error 1: Controller input “Auto” is TRUE,

please set it to False

-2 — Error 2: Auto tune error, the ATDynaSet time

expired

OutGains

Output

GAIN_PID

Gains calculated from AutoTune Sequences. See
GAIN PID Data type

ENO

Output

BOOL

Enable out.
Only applicable to LD, “ENO” is not required in FBD
programming.

GAIN_PID Data Type

Parameter

Type

Description

DirectActing

BOOL

Types of acting:

TRUE – Direct acting

FALSE – Reverse acting

ProportionalGain

REAL

Proportional gain for PID ( >= 0.0001)

TimeIntegral

REAL

Time integral value for PID ( >= 0.0001)

TimeDerivative

REAL

Time derivative value for PID ( >= 0.0)

DerivativeGain

REAL

Derivative gain for PID ( >= 0.0)

AT_Param Data Type

Parameter

Type

Description

Load

REAL

Initial controller value for autotuning process.

Deviation

REAL

Deviation for auto tuning. This is the standard deviation used to
evaluate the noise band needed for AutoTune (noise band = 3*
Deviation)
